桌面应用程序浅谈

2019年8月28 第一次尝试学习了之前听过的c#语言。
下载了vs2019.

.Net

  • 是一个开发平台 类似java平台。但是在.Net平台上支持多种语言。C#是其支持的最重要的一门语言之一。

winforms

  • 脚本都是基于c#,winforms是做客户端软件,WinForm是.Net开发平台中对Windows Form的一种称谓。
    下图是第一次编写的 winform程序(连接Mysql 实现了 注册登录)
    在这里插入图片描述

WPF

WPF(Windows Presentation Foundation)是微软推出的基于Windows 的用户界面框架,属于.NET Framework 3.0的一部分。它提供了统一的编程模型、语言和框架,真正做到了分离界面设计人员与开发人员的工作;同时它提供了全新的多媒体交互用户图形界面。
XMAL(Extensible Application Markup Language 聆听i/ˈzæməl/)是Windows Presentation Foundation(WPF)的一部分,是微软开发的一种基于XML、基于声明,用于初始化结构化值和对象的用户界面描述语言,它有着HTML的外观,又揉合了XML语法的本质,例如:可以使用标签设置按钮(Button)

WPF和以前的WinForm有什么区别?
起初认为:没什么区别,仅仅是表示层用XAML封了层皮,使得Windows看起来更炫了。

发布了43 篇原创文章 · 获赞 13 · 访问量 4899

猜你喜欢

转载自blog.csdn.net/qq_30693057/article/details/100130090